Dissecting the Fresh Beef Burger: Calories and Macronutrients
A fresh beef burger’s nutritional value begins with its core component: the beef patty. The caloric content is heavily influenced by the fat-to-lean ratio of the ground beef used. A patty made from 80/20 ground beef (80% lean, 20% fat) will contain more calories and fat than one made from a leaner blend, such as 90/10. For example, a 4-ounce patty from 80/20 beef might have around 280-300 calories, while the same size patty from 90/10 beef drops to roughly 200-220 calories. The cooking method also plays a role; pan-frying in added oil increases the total fat and calorie count, whereas grilling allows some of the fat to render away.
The macronutrient profile of a beef burger is typically dominated by protein and fat. Protein is crucial for muscle building, hormone production, and overall cellular function. A single beef burger patty can provide a substantial amount of protein, making it an excellent source for individuals with high protein needs. The carbohydrate content of a fresh beef burger primarily comes from the bun. Choosing a whole-grain bun can add dietary fiber, which is important for digestive health, while a simple white bun adds more simple carbs and less fiber. The fat in a burger consists of both saturated and unsaturated fats, with the ratio depending on the leanness of the beef. While saturated fat intake should be limited, the other components contribute to a balanced energy intake.
The Micronutrient Powerhouse: Vitamins and Minerals
Beyond the primary macronutrients, a fresh beef burger is a valuable source of several essential micronutrients. The beef itself is particularly rich in several key vitamins and minerals that are critical for bodily functions:
- Iron: Essential for red blood cell production and oxygen transport throughout the body. Red meat provides heme iron, which is more easily absorbed by the body than non-heme iron found in plant-based sources.
- Zinc: An important trace mineral that supports a healthy immune system and cellular metabolism.
- Vitamin B12: Found exclusively in animal products, B12 is vital for nerve function, DNA synthesis, and red blood cell formation.
- Selenium: An essential trace element that functions as an antioxidant and is important for thyroid health.
- Niacin (Vitamin B3): Plays a role in converting food into energy and in DNA repair.
- Phosphorus: Crucial for bone growth and energy storage.
The overall micronutrient profile can be enhanced by the toppings used. For example, adding fresh lettuce, tomato, and onion can provide additional vitamins like Vitamin A and C, as well as fiber. The addition of cheese provides calcium, but also increases the saturated fat and sodium content.
Comparison: Homemade vs. Fast Food Beef Burger
There is a stark difference in nutritional value between a homemade fresh beef burger and its fast-food counterpart. Homemade burgers offer complete control over ingredients, portion sizes, and preparation methods, which are typically healthier.
| Feature | Homemade Fresh Beef Burger | Fast-Food Beef Burger | 
|---|---|---|
| Ground Beef | Choice of lean-to-fat ratio (e.g., 90/10 or 95/5) | Often uses higher-fat beef blends | 
| Cooking Method | Typically pan-broiled or grilled, using minimal added fats | Fried or grilled on a greasy surface; oils may be highly processed | 
| Sodium Content | Lower sodium, controlled by seasoning | Significantly higher due to additives, processed cheese, and sauces | 
| Bun | Option for wholegrain or low-carb alternatives | Often uses a sugary white bread bun | 
| Toppings | Fresh, unprocessed vegetables; homemade sauces | Processed ingredients; high-sugar, high-fat sauces | 
| Overall Quality | Higher quality, less processed ingredients | Lower nutrient density, often contains additives | 
Optimizing Your Beef Burger for Maximum Nutrition
To ensure your fresh beef burger is as nutritious as possible, consider the following preparation tips:
- Choose Lean Beef: Opt for ground beef with a higher lean-to-fat ratio (e.g., 90/10 or 95/5) to reduce overall calorie and saturated fat intake.
- Incorporate Vegetables: Mix finely chopped mushrooms or onions into the beef patty to boost flavor, fiber, and micronutrients.
- Mind the Bun: Select a wholegrain or wholemeal bun for added fiber and complex carbohydrates. Consider a lettuce wrap as a low-carb alternative.
- Pile on the Veggies: Load up on fresh vegetables like lettuce, tomatoes, onions, and avocado for extra vitamins and antioxidants.
- Make Your Own Sauce: Avoid sugary, store-bought condiments. Create your own healthier versions with Greek yogurt, herbs, and spices.
- Use Healthy Fats: When cooking, use a heart-healthy oil like olive oil, or pan-broil the patty without added fat.
- Add Healthy Toppings: Include healthy toppings such as pickles, fermented vegetables, or a slice of fresh tomato instead of processed cheese.
Conclusion: A Fresh Beef Burger can be a Healthy Option
The nutritional value of a fresh beef burger is highly variable and depends on its ingredients and preparation. While a fast-food burger can be a high-calorie, low-nutrient indulgence, a thoughtfully prepared homemade version can be a balanced and nutritious meal. By selecting lean beef, opting for wholegrain buns, and loading up on fresh vegetables, you can create a delicious and healthy fresh beef burger that provides high-quality protein, essential vitamins, and key minerals. The power to control what goes into your meal allows you to transform this classic dish into a healthier option for your diet.
